Pitch and Conditions
The pitch in Vadodara has favoured batters and bowlers in equal measure this season. Typically, scores around 160-plus have been challenging to chase, while totals under 160 have been chased comfortably in most games. Seam bowlers have been particularly effective in the powerplay, making early breakthroughs crucial.
Pace vs spin at Vadodara in WPL 2026
BowlType | Balls | Runs | Wkts | Ave | SR | Econ | Dot% | Bnd% |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Pace | 1269 | 1645 | 66 | 24.92 | 19.2 | 7.77 | 42.7 | 18.91 |
Spin | 1009 | 1304 | 55 | 23.7 | 18.3 | 7.75 | 32.3 | 15.75 |
Key Battles to Watch
Powerplay Fireworks: RCB’s opening duo — led by Smriti Mandhana and the explosive Grace Harris — has been among the most consistent in the competition. Their quick starts put pressure on bowling attacks early.
DC’s Top Order Punch: Shafali Verma, known for her aggressive batting, has been exceptional against RCB in previous clashes this season and could make a big impact at the top.
Pace vs Spin: Both teams rely heavily on their seamers to strike early. RCB’s fast bowlers have been slightly more effective in the powerplay, while DC’s bowlers have chipped in with valuable wickets as well.
Pace vs spin for both teams in WPL 2026
Team | Bowl Type | Mat | Wkts | Ave | Econ | SR | Dot% | Bnd% |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
RCB | pace | 8 | 36 | 18.47 | 7.07 | 15.6 | 44.1 | 15.95 |
DC | pace | 9 | 38 | 20.55 | 7.63 | 16.1 | 42.6 | 17.58 |
RCB | spin | 8 | 17 | 29.58 | 8.31 | 21.3 | 35.5 | 19.28 |
DC | spin | 9 | 23 | 28.08 | 8.5 | 19.8 | 29.3 | 18.42 |
